The Minnesota Twins (63-75) lost their fourth straight game, falling to the Astros 5-2 Tuesday at Minute Maid Park in Houston.

Houston got off to another quick start, scoring four runs in the first inning off Minnesota starting pitcher Trevor May. May wouldn't see the second inning.

The Twins made it interesting in the second, loading the bases -- but leaving them that way without scoring a run.

Minnesota managed a run in the third, and another in the ninth, but it was too little, too late.

Miguel Sano was injured sliding into second base, and needed to be carted off the field in the second inning. X-rays were negative, and he's listed as day-to-day with a bruise.
